Thomson Unveils Grass Valley HD LDK 8000 SportCam

At IBC 2007, Thomson announced the addition of Super SloMo functionality to its entire Grass Valley standard HD camera family.
The LDK 8000 SportCam has already been pre-ordered by a major customer for use during the 2008 Summer Olympics in Beijing, China.
The entire line of Grass Valley LDK cameras addresses customers' on-going need for fully upgradeable, future-proof and multiformat-capable products and systems that are affordable and flexible in order to maximize their media investment.
The Grass Valley LDK 8000 SportCam is a two-piece dockable camera system, fully compatible with all current LDK HD sub-systems. By adding the capability for 2x recording, it means that mobile production companies can outfit an entire truck with them, using some for slo-mo and others for standard HD acquisition alongside regular LDK 8000 cameras.
The LDK 8000 SportCam uses the same imaging and video processing technology as the standard LDK 8000, including a proven architecture with 14-bit analogue-to-digital conversion and 22-bit internal digital signal processing. What makes it unique is its ability to shoot at double speed - either 100 Hz or 119.88 Hz, depending on the HD format - and record to an external third-party disk recorder.
During recording, concurrent HD and high-quality oversampled SD outputs are available. It is the only slow motion camera available that can capture true progressive HD images, natively, in multiple formats and frame rates. This makes the LDK 8000 Sport Cam the slow motion camera of choice for almost any OB or mobile truck application.
Maintaining flexibility for mobile productions, particularly sporting events, the LDK 8000 SportCam uses the same triax or fibre optic cable, often pre-installed in stadiums, and used by other LDK Series cameras. Triax cable can be used for distances up to 1200m (3,500 feet), which can be doubled by use of an HD triax repeater without significant loss of picture quality.
The LDK 8000 SportCam has the same controls, look, and feel as the existing range of LDK HD cameras, making it intuitive to operators while providing the same high picture quality to viewers.
With more than 600 units sold worldwide since its introduction at IBC last year, the Grass Valley LDK 8000 family of HD cameras now includes three versions: Standard, WorldCam, and Sport.
The Standard version supports 1080i/720p HD formats in 50 and 59.94 Hz, and simultaneously provides high-quality SD output in either 50 or 59.94 Hz.
The WorldCam version adds support for all recognized worldwide HD formats, including 24p for digital cinematography acquisition and 1080p50/60 output.
